文章目录
各位25届计算机专业的小伙伴们,还在为毕设选题而迷茫吗?在为选定后难度大而担忧吗?根据题目要求到底要做成什么样的系统,难度大不大?工作量够不够?能顺利通过答辩吗?
今天博主为大家整理了一些相关毕设选题的相关推荐与建议,为各位小伙伴们答疑解惑,带大家了解关于毕设选题的那些事。
同时,博主在文末还为各位小伙伴准备了相关参考源码以及免费的毕业答辩模板,供大家学习与使用;
1. 选题看的眼花缭乱,到底哪个更适合我?
计算机专业的选题所涉及的方向是相当的多,如网络安全、机器学习,移动端应用(小程序、app等)、爬虫、基于xx管理系统、基于xx预约系统,基于xx平台系统,基于xx的销售系统等等,让人眼花缭乱,无处下手;
可以从以下几点做考虑(排列优先级)
-
技术掌握程度: 根据自己对不同技术的熟悉程度。例如,如果你对 Java 比较熟悉,可以选择基于 Java 的框架(如 Spring Boot、SSM 等)来开发;擅长Python,可以考虑相关的框架(如 Django 等),或是机器学习,网络安全方面等,第一考虑还是以编程语言为主,切勿对自己抱有太高预期(后面可以再学);
-
个人兴趣: 在评估完自己技术掌握度的前提下,尽可能选择自己感兴趣的方面,或是考虑以后要从事的工作方向。对于缺少项目经验的同学来说,毕设系统,同样也可成为简历上浓墨重彩的一笔,增加竞争力;并且在实现与探索过程中,通过理论与实践的相结合,也是个很好的学习提升自己能力的机会;
-
题目覆盖范围: 尽量选择覆盖范围较小、具体的题目,避免过于宽泛的选题,可减少与指导老师在认识上的偏差所造成的影响。例如,将“商城系统”细化为“基于特定技术的某类产品商城系统”,或者将“旅游网站”限定为某个具体城市的旅游网站,或是基于具体某某技术的实现;
-
避免高重复率: 尽量避开那些常见的、被很多人选择过的题目,如图书管理系统、教务管理系统等,防止题目重复,并且也可降低论文的重复率。可以通过给系统添加特色前缀名的方式来降低重复率;
-
已有资源和参考资料:考虑是否有相关的项目源码、代码示例、论文或教程等资源可供参考;
除以上之外,在确定选题之前,还要考虑系统的创新点、实用性和实际需求等,总的来说还是以能实现为主;还可以主动与导师沟通,征求他们的建议和意见。另外也可以参考其他相关的毕业设计,了解他们在类似选题中遇到的问题和解决方法。
2. 指导老师的重要性
在毕业设计的过程中,选择指导老师至关重要。有些老师可能追求完美,会对你的设计方案吹毛求疵,不断提出各种问题和修改意见。但实际上老师的行为动机是好的!
也存在另外一些极端情况,有极少的老师可能会故意刁难你。他们或许对你的努力视而不见,无论你如何努力改进,都难以得到他们的认可。让人感到沮丧和无助,严重影响你的毕业设计进度和心态。
**因此,慎重选择指导老师是极为重要的!**
- 经验丰富且专业知识扎实:他们在相关领域有深厚的造诣,并且了解学生的技术水平,能够给予您准确且有深度的指导,帮助您避免一些常见的错误和弯路。
- 口碑良好:可以向学长学姐打听,了解哪些老师在指导毕业设计时认真负责、公平公正,能够给予学生切实有效的帮助。
- **责任心强:**老师们在平时上课,及进行科研项目的同时,也要关注到你的毕设相关事宜,精力分散较为严重;责任心强的老师能及时传达学校安排,给出合理建议,对你的毕设给予指导与督促,防止出现因老师的失误而造成的毕业问题。
- 善于沟通和倾听的老师:他们能够耐心倾听你的想法和困惑,理解你的思路,和你保持良好的交流。鼓励你尝试新的方法和思路,培养你的创造力与独立解决问题的能力。
总之,在选择指导老师时,也应尽可能的去下功夫了解,如口碑、指导风格、专业水平以及与学生的沟通方式等,选择大于努力,望各位小伙伴慎之
标签:选题,基于,毕设,实现,微信,系统,百套,设计 From: https://blog.csdn.net/weixin_51756171/article/details/141392414